What is the value of X in the given triangle?

Answer: x = 65.4

==================================================

Work Shown:

cos(angle) = adjacent/hypotenuse

cos(x) = 5/12

x = arccos(5/12)

x = 65.375681647836 which is approximate

x = 65.4 after rounding to one decimal place

Make sure your calculator is in degree mode. The arccosine function is the same as the inverse cosine function (shortened to
\cos^(-1) ).
